Abbeymead Rovers Hawks 5 Ashelworth Woodpeckers 0

Mid Glos Mini-Soccer League
Saturday 18th March 2006

Ashelworth came to face the league leaders with a lot of confidence after some good recent results. Their record shows that they are a hard team to break down and they proved this again. The first fifthteen minutes was very tight. In fact Ashelworth caused defenders Josh Cannon and Elliot Basford some problems and they looked quite threatening but the pair defended well. Clayton Dee broke free from his marker and put over a lovely cross which Ben Langworthy nearly converted. Elliot Obee's pass found Dee and his strength took him clear from the defence only for his shot to be saved, but Jamal Lawrence was on hand to put away the rebound. Abbeymead grew in confidence, Brodie Goddard-Jones and Obee dominated the midfield and made things tick. Obee's pass found Joe Wilton whose effort was blocked and Goddard-Jones fired the rebound just over the bar. Obee again won the ball and found Goddard-Jones who put Dee through to score the second.

In the second half Dee was a constant threat and had several shots just wide. Ashelworth still looked a threat on the break and George Hall had to make an excellent save low to his left. The third goal was superb and eased the pressure - Basford won the ball and passed to Cannon who fed Wilton. He passed down the line to Lawrence who switched play to Langworthy who passed to Obee whose cross was turned in by Lawrence - what a team goal. Obee and Langworthy again combined well to allow Lawrence to score his third. Before the end Langworthy again fed man of the match Lawrence for his fourth. For Ashelworth, Harry Benfield was strong in midfield and their player of the match Isaac Townsend made an excellent debut.
